My Buying Guides on 12 X 12 Canopy Replacement

Why I Needed a 12 x 12 Canopy Replacement

When I started looking for a 12 x 12 canopy replacement, I realized how important it was to get the right fit, material, and durability. My old canopy top had faded, torn, and stopped giving me the shade I needed. I wanted something that could handle sun, light rain, and regular outdoor use without wearing out too quickly.

What I Looked for First

The first thing I checked was the exact size. Since I needed a 12 x 12 canopy replacement, I made sure the measurements matched my frame. I also looked at the type of frame I had, because not every replacement top works with every canopy structure. Getting the right fit saved me a lot of frustration later.

Material Quality Matters

I learned that the material makes a huge difference. I preferred a heavy-duty polyester or oxford fabric because it felt more reliable for outdoor use. I also looked for UV protection and water resistance. In my experience, a canopy replacement that blocks sunlight well and resists light rain is worth paying a little extra for.

Frame Compatibility

I made sure the replacement top was designed for my canopy frame style. Some tops use Velcro straps, while others use pockets or hook-and-loop attachments. I found that a secure attachment system matters because it helps the canopy stay in place during breezy conditions.

Ventilation Features

One feature I appreciated was a vented top. In my experience, airflow helps reduce heat buildup underneath the canopy. A vent also made the canopy feel more stable when the wind picked up a little. If I were buying again, I would still choose a replacement with good ventilation.

Ease of Installation

I wanted a canopy replacement that I could install without needing special tools. The easier it was to set up, the better. I looked for clear instructions and a design that could be attached quickly. For me, a simple installation process was a big advantage, especially when I needed a fast replacement.

Durability and Weather Resistance

I paid attention to reinforced stitching, thicker fabric, and strong seams. These details told me the replacement was built to last. Since outdoor gear faces sun, wind, and moisture, I wanted something that could stand up to repeated use. In my experience, durability is one of the most important things to check.

Color and Style Choices

I also considered color. Lighter colors helped reflect heat, while darker colors gave a cleaner, more polished look. I chose a color that matched my outdoor setup and still provided the shade I wanted. Style may not be the top priority, but it definitely matters if you care about the overall appearance.

Budget vs. Value

I found that the cheapest option was not always the best value. I compared price with material quality, warranty, and features. Sometimes spending a little more gave me a canopy replacement that lasted much longer. For me, value mattered more than just the lowest price.
